首页>>帮助中心>>香港云服务器mysql数据库降低死锁的优化建议

香港云服务器mysql数据库降低死锁的优化建议

2024/8/8 135次
对于香港云服务器的mysql数据库降低死锁做出以下优化建议:
1.减少事务中的代码执行时间:尽量减少事务中的代码执行时间,避免长时间占用资源,减少死锁发生的可能性。
2.避免频繁更新同一行数据:如果多个事务需要频繁更新同一行数据,可以考虑调整事务的执行顺序,避免死锁的发生。
3.使用合适的事务隔离级别:根据实际情况选择合适的事务隔离级别,避免不必要的锁竞争。
4.合理设计数据库索引:合理设计数据库索引可以提高查询效率,减少锁的竞争,降低死锁的风险。
5.使用批量操作:尽量使用批量操作来减少数据库操作的次数,减少锁的竞争,降低死锁的概率。
6.监控和调整事务超时时间:及时监控事务的超时时间,并根据情况调整超时时间,避免长时间占用资源导致死锁。
7.使用数据库死锁检测工具:使用数据库提供的死锁检测工具来检测和解决死锁问题,及时处理死锁情况。

一诺网络香港免备案专区,提供「香港增强云服务器」和「香港特惠云服务器」两种类型的高可用弹性计算服务,搭载新一代英特尔®至强®铂金处理器,接入CN2低延时高速回国带宽线路,网络访问顺滑、流畅。机房网络架构采用了BGP协议的解决方案可提供多线路互联融合网络,使得不同网络运营商线路的用户都能通过最佳路由实现快速访问。香港云服务器低至29/月,购买链接:https://www.enuoidc.com/vps.html?typeid=2